I’m trying to install Comodo Time Machine 2.6.138262.166 on an Emachines T3504 on Windows XP home SP3.
It installs except for the hang installing the ClientService.exe service I reported here: https://forums.comodo.com/help-ctm/installing-comodo-time-machine-is-hanging-t55605.0.html
and I reboot the machine to finish the install.
The machine reboots and the install finishes (it hangs for ~60 seconds at 3%) and starts booting Windows:
I get my screen giving me a choice of booting windows XP or the windows recovery console
then the screen goes black for ~90 seconds (this does not happen without CTM)
then I get the usual booting Windows XP screen for ~7 seconds and
then it reboots,
and this cycle repeats.
Luckily when the CTM screen appears I can press the home key and choose uninstall and it uninstalls sucessfully.
I really don’t think the hanging problem has anything to do with the rebooting problem.
I got the hanging problem on 3 other XP machines, worked around it in exactly the same way,
and none of them had the rebooting problem.
FYI: After the rebooting problem with CTM on this one machine, I tried to install EAZ-FIX V9.1
and it installed and rebooted without any problems and seems to works fine .
